Main Blog Content Prompt Engineering involves designing and refining natural language prompts that can be used to train AI models or interact with existing ones. The goal is to create questions that are clear, concise, and well-defined, allowing machines to understand the intended meaning and respond accordingly.
To illustrate this concept, consider a simple example: asking a chatbot about the weather in New York City. A poorly crafted prompt might be "What's the weather like?" which could lead to a confusing or irrelevant response. In contrast, a well-designed prompt would be "What is the current temperature and humidity level in New York City?" This revised query provides more context and specificity, making it easier for the chatbot to understand and respond accurately.
Challenges
Prompt Engineering faces several challenges:
- Ambiguity: Natural language is inherently ambiguous, with words and phrases having multiple meanings.
- Contextual dependence: The meaning of a prompt can depend on the surrounding context, which may not be easily captured by AI models.
- Domain knowledge: Prompt Engineers need to possess domain-specific expertise to craft effective prompts that are relevant to a particular field or industry.
Applications The importance of Prompt Engineering lies in its potential to unlock more accurate and reliable interactions between humans and machines. Applications include:
- Conversational AI: Developing chatbots, virtual assistants, and voice-controlled interfaces that can understand and respond to user queries.
- Natural Language Processing (NLP): Improving the performance of NLP models by creating high-quality prompts that help them learn from data.
- Generative Models: Crafting prompts that elicit creative and meaningful responses from generative models like language translation systems or text summarization tools.
